Maldonado: Williams exit was a bad decision

With Williams on the up and Lotus' future yet to be resolved, Pastor Maldonado concedes leaving Williams was 'not a great' decision. The 30-year-old's Formula 1 career began with the Williams team in 2011. However, after three trying seasons – which did include a surprise victory at the 2012 Spanish GP – he swapped to Lotus. That move co-incided with a resurgance for Williams. While Lotus struggled for pace and reliability, not helped by Maldonado's crashes, Williams claimed nine podium results on their way to third in the Championship. It has been more of the same this season as crashes and reliability have hampered Maldonado while Williams have again been fight for podiums....
